About the Event

The Award-Winning St. Patrick's Choral Society return to the beautiful surroundings of The Great Hall, Downpatrick after a hugely successful run in Belfast's Grand Opera House!

Come join us this February as we bring you the classic family musical 'ANNIE' set in 1930s New York during The Great Depression, brave young Annie is forced to live a life of misery and torment at Miss Hannigan’s orphanage. Determined to find her real parents, her luck changes when she is chosen to spend Christmas at the residence of famous billionaire, Oliver Warbucks. Spiteful Miss Hannigan has other ideas and hatches a plan to spoil Annie’s search.

With its award-winning book and score brought to life by some of Northern Irelands most respected musicians, this stunning musical “pulls out all the stops” and includes the unforgettable songs Hard Knock Life, Easy Street, I Don’t Need Anything But You and Tomorrow. “A show no one should miss”!
